- The distance between Krasnoyarsk, Russia and Clarksdale, Ms, Usa is approximately 10,001 km or 6,215 mi.
- To reach Krasnoyarsk in this distance one would set out from Clarksdale, Ms bearing 357.8°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Krasnoyarsk bearing 183.2° or S .
- Krasnoyarsk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Clarksdale,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Krasnoyarsk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Clarksdale,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 15.9 °C (28.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.1 °C (23.6°F) more in Krasnoyarsk.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 910.7 mm (35.9 in) less which is equivalent to 910.7 l/m² (22.35 US gal/ft²) or 9,107,000 l/ha (973,599 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22° lower in Krasnoyarsk than in Clarksdale, Ms.
